Gunicorn 'Green Unicorn' is an open source Python WSGI HTTP Server for UNIX. It's a pre-fork worker model. The Gunicorn server is presented as broadly compatible with various web frameworks, simply implemented, light on server resources, and fairly speedy.N/A

Application Server is an expanded server role in the Windows ServerĀ® 2008 operating system. It provided an integrated environment for deploying and running custom, server-based business applications. These applications respond to requests that arrive over the network from remote client computers or from other applications. Application Server is deprecated.N/A
